The Rise of Polyurea

Polyurea is a coating that has garnered acclaim, for its characteristics. Developed in the 1980s, polyurea is a spray-on coating that sets quickly to form a flexible waterproof barrier.
Polyurea stands out from coatings because it can be applied at different temperatures and humidity levels, making it perfect for different settings.

One of the reasons why polyurea is preferred in the coatings industry is its durability. It can withstand chemicals, UV rays and physical impacts providing lasting protection in challenging environments. This quality makes polyurea a popular option for flooring, marine coatings and pipeline preservation.

Another reason polyurea is used is its curing time. Unlike coatings that may require hours or days to cure, polyurea sets rapidly within minutes. This allows for turnaround times and minimal operational downtime, especially beneficial in industries where time efficiency is crucial.

The versatility of polyurea is also worth noting. It can be applied on surfaces like metal, concrete, and wood while adhering well to irregular shapes and surfaces. This versatility enables its use in an array of applications ranging from roof waterproofing to tank lining and pond protection.

The Strength of Polyurea

A standout feature of polyurea is its toughness, as it creates a flexible membrane upon application that resists cracks and peeling.
This adaptability enables it to withstand impact without compromising the coating integrity, making it perfect for safeguarding surfaces exposed to usage or harsh environments.

Additionally, polyurea’s resistance to chemicals and UV rays enhances its durability. Unlike some coatings that may deteriorate over time when exposed to sunlight or harsh chemicals polyurea retains its qualities ensuring lasting effectiveness. This quality makes it a dependable option for industries like oil and gas where substance exposure is common.

Additionally, an important aspect of polyurea’s toughness is its capability to bridge gaps and seal joints. Upon application, polyurea expands to fill cracks and empty spaces, forming a barrier that prevents water infiltration and corrosion. This characteristic is especially valuable in projects where maintaining the coating’s integrity is crucial in preventing leaks and water damage.
